The top 10 most watched TV shows in 2017 have been revealed.
At number one was Blue Planet II which was aired on BBC One. On October 29 the show managed to get 14.1 million views.
The wildlife series which was narrated by Sir David Attenborough included footage of walruses fighting to find a home along with dazzling scenes of surfing dolphins and a sex-changing fish.
The success of this show was enough for the BBC to hold on to its title as the home of the biggest TV audience of the year.
Second place also went to the BBC due to the 13 million people who watched the final of Strictly Come Dancing.
The final saw Joe McFadden and his dance partner Kataya Jones lift the glitterball trophy.
